Drum Type Onion Grading Machine Working Principle
This equipment employs the classic drum screening principle, optimized for the characteristics of onions. Onions to be graded are evenly fed into a large, slowly rotating drum, either horizontally or slightly inclined, by an elevator or conveyor belt. The drum consists of several sections of screen cylinders with varying apertures, increasing in size from front to back. As the drum rotates at a constant speed, the onions gently tumble and move forward within the drum. The smallest onions fall first through the first section of the small-aperture screen, medium-sized onions through subsequent screens, and the largest onions are discharged from the end of the drum. This method of natural sorting based on gravity and rolling minimizes impact, effectively preventing damage to the onion skin and ensuring accurate size sorting.

Onion Sorting Machine Features
Multi-layer progressive grading screen drum: The drum is composed of 3-5 sections of 304 stainless steel perforated screens of different specifications. The screen aperture size is customized according to customer standards (such as EU, US, or Asian market standards), achieving precise grading from extremely small to extra-large sizes.
Variable frequency speed control drive system and adjustable tilt angle: Equipped with a variable frequency motor, the drum speed can be precisely controlled (typically 5-15 rpm) to adapt to the rolling resistance of different varieties of onions. The overall tilt angle is adjustable, further controlling the residence time and flow speed of materials within the drum.
Low-damage internal guide plate design: The drum is equipped with specially designed flexible or spiral guide plates, which not only effectively convey and tumble onions, preventing accumulation, but also cushion collisions, significantly reducing the skin breakage rate compared to rigid baffles.
Modular structure and large-capacity hopper: The equipment adopts a modular design for easy maintenance and expansion. Equipped with a large feed hopper and a wide conveyor belt, it ensures a continuous and uniform supply of raw materials, fully utilizing the drum’s efficient grading capabilities.
